New-CMApplication
建立應用程式。
語法
New-CMApplication
[-AddOwner <String[]>]
[-AddSupportContact <String[]>]
[-AppCatalog <AppDisplayInfo[]>]
[-AutoInstall <Boolean>]
[-DefaultLanguageId <Int32>]
[-Description <String>]
[-DisplaySupersedenceInApplicationCatalog <Boolean>]
[-IconLocationFile <String>]
[-IsFeatured <Boolean>]
[-Keyword <String[]>]
[-LinkText <String>]
[-LocalizedDescription <String>]
[-LocalizedName <String>]
[-Name] <String>
[-OptionalReference <String>]
[-Owner <String>]
[-PrivacyUrl <String>]
[-Publisher <String>]
[-ReleaseDate <DateTime>]
[-SoftwareVersion <String>]
[-SupportContact <String>]
[-UserDocumentation <String>]
[-DisableWildcardHandling]
[-ForceWildcardHandling]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
使用此 Cmdlet 建立應用程式。 Configuration Manager 應用程式會定義應用程式的相關元數據。 如需詳細資訊,請 參閱在 Configuration Manager 中建立應用程式。
注意事項
從 Configuration Manager 月臺磁碟驅動器執行 Configuration Manager Cmdlet,例如 PS XYZ:\>
。 如需詳細資訊,請 參閱開始使用。
範例
範例 1:建立應用程式
此命令會建立名為Application01的應用程式。
New-CMApplication -Name "Application01" -Description "New Application" -Publisher "Contoso" -SoftwareVersion "1.0.0.1" -OptionalReference "Reference" -ReleaseDate 2/24/2016 -AutoInstall $True -Owner "Administrator" -SupportContact "Administrator" -LocalizedName "Application01" -UserDocumentation "https://contoso.com/content" -LinkText "For more information" -LocalizedDescription "New Localized Application" -Keyword "application" -PrivacyUrl "https://contoso.com/library/privacy" -IsFeatured $True -IconLocationFile "\\central\icons\icon.png"
參數
-AddOwner
指定負責此應用程式的一或多個系統管理使用者。
類型: | String[] |
別名: | AddOwners |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-AddSupportContact
指定使用者可以連絡的一或多個系統管理使用者,以取得此應用程式的協助。
類型: | String[] |
別名: | AddSupportContacts |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-AppCatalog
使用此參數來指定特定語言的軟體中心專案。 這個項目可以包含應用程式的所有本地化資訊:
- 描述
- IconLocationFile
- 關鍵字
- LinkText
- PrivacyUrl
- 標題
- UserDocumentation
若要取得此物件,請使用 New-CMApplicationDisplayInfo Cmdlet。
類型: | AppDisplayInfo[] |
別名: | AppCatalogs |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-AutoInstall
將此參數設定 為 $true ,以允許從 [安裝應用程式] 工作順序步驟安裝應用程式,而不需要部署。
類型: | Boolean |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-Confirm
執行 Cmdlet 之前提示您確認。
類型: | SwitchParameter |
別名: | cf |
Position: | Named |
預設值: | False |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-DefaultLanguageId
指定預設軟體中心語言的語言標識碼。
此標識子是 Windows 語言識別子的小數對等專案。 例如, 1033
0x0409
適用於 英文 (美國) ,而 2108
0x083C
適用於 愛爾蘭 () 。 如需詳細資訊,請參閱 [MS-LCID]: Windows 語言代碼識別碼 (LCID) 參考。
類型: | Int32 |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-Description
指定應用程式的選擇性系統管理員批注。 最大長度為 2048 個字元。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-DisableWildcardHandling
此參數會將通配符視為常值字元值。 您無法將其與 ForceWildcardHandling 結合。
類型: | SwitchParameter |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-DisplaySupersedenceInApplicationCatalog
請勿使用此參數。 不再支援應用程式類別目錄。
類型: | Boolean |
別名: | DisplaySupersedencesInApplicationCatalog |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-ForceWildcardHandling
此參數會處理通配符,並可能導致非預期的行為 (不建議) 。 您無法將其與 DisableWildcardHandling 結合。
類型: | SwitchParameter |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-IconLocationFile
指定包含此應用程式圖示的檔案路徑。 圖示可以有最多 512x512 的像素維度。 檔案可以是下列影像和圖示檔案類型:
- DLL
- EXE
- JPG
- ICO
- PNG
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-IsFeatured
將此參數設定為 $true ,以將此應用程式顯示為精選應用程式,並在公司入口網站中反白顯示。
類型: | Boolean |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-Keyword
以選取的語言指定關鍵詞清單。 這些關鍵詞可協助軟體中心用戶搜尋應用程式。
提示
若要新增多個關鍵詞,請使用 CultureInfo.CurrentCulture.TextInfo.ListSeparator 作為分隔符。
類型: | String[] |
別名: | Keywords |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-LinkText
當您使用 UserDocumentation 參數時,請使用此參數來顯示字串,以取代軟體中心的「其他資訊」。 最大長度為 128 個字元。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-LocalizedDescription
以選取的語言指定此應用程式的描述。 最大長度為 2048 個字元。
類型: | String |
別名: | LocalizedApplicationDescription |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-LocalizedName
以選取的語言指定應用程式名稱。 此名稱會出現在軟體中心。
您新增的每個語言都需要名稱。
最大長度為 256 個字元。
類型: | String |
別名: | LocalizedApplicationName |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-Name
指定應用程式的名稱。 最大長度為 256 個字元。
類型: | String |
別名: | LocalizedDisplayName |
Position: | 0 |
預設值: | None |
必要: | True |
接受管線輸入: | False |
接受萬用字元: | False |
-OptionalReference
指定選擇性字串,以協助您在控制台中尋找應用程式。 最大長度為 256 個字元。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-Owner
指定負責此應用程式的系統管理使用者。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-PrivacyUrl
指定應用程式隱私聲明的網站位址。 格式必須是有效的 URL,例如 https://contoso.com/privacy
。 整個字串的最大長度為 128 個字元。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-Publisher
指定此應用程式的選擇性廠商資訊。 最大長度為 256 個字元。
類型: | String |
別名: | Manufacturer |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-ReleaseDate
指定此應用程式發行時間的日期物件。 若要取得此物件,請使用 Get-Date 內建 Cmdlet。
類型: | DateTime |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-SoftwareVersion
指定應用程式的選擇性版本字串。 最大長度為 64 個字元。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-SupportContact
指定使用者可以連絡的系統管理使用者,以取得此應用程式的協助。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-UserDocumentation
指定檔案的位置,讓軟體中心使用者可以從中取得此應用程式的詳細資訊。 此位置是網站位址,或網路路徑和檔名。 請確定使用者可以存取此位置。
整個字串的最大長度為 256 個字元。
類型: | String |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-WhatIf
顯示執行 Cmdlet 時會發生什麼情況。 Cmdlet 不會執行。
類型: | SwitchParameter |
別名: | wi |
Position: | Named |
預設值: | False |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
輸入
None
輸出
IResultObject
IResultObject
備註
如需這個傳回物件及其屬性的詳細資訊,請 參閱SMS_Application伺服器 WMI 類別。